Hi,
I have a working basic openser + asterisk setup. Twinkle works OK and wengophone doesn't. It tries to connect and then after a while times out.
While debugging I noticed a lot of OPTIONS ping requests are going unanswered by openser because it contains an user in the uri. Registration seems to be working OK.
I've attached the ngrep output that shows this.
Has anyone got wengophone to work with openser?
-- Radu Spineanu
interface: eth0 (217.73.174.0/255.255.255.224) filter: (ip or ip6) and ( port 5060 ) # U 82.79.243.82:5060 -> 217.73.174.13:5060 REGISTER sip:217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=123456789..Route: sip:217.73.174.13;lr..From: nobo dy sip:nobody@217.73.174.13;tag=123456789..To: sip:nobody@217.73.174.13..Call-ID: 000001@ping..Contact: sip:nobody@82.79.243.82..C Seq: 2 REGISTER..Content-Length: 0.... # U 217.73.174.13:5060 -> 82.79.243.82:5060 SIP/2.0 401 Unauthorized..Via: SIP/2.0/UDP 82.79.243.82:5060;rport=5060;branch=123456789..From: nobody sip:nobody@217.73.174.13;tag=12 3456789..To: sip:nobody@217.73.174.13;tag=5e02e7658def22f683939a852e493344.3f4e..Call-ID: 000001@ping..CSeq: 2 REGISTER..WWW-Authentic ate: Digest realm="217.73.174.13", nonce="46823bd8e5f68588801e0655bbc907e2425ee03f"..Server: OpenSER (1.2.1-notls (x86_64/linux))..Conte nt-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 REGISTER sip:217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1094221745..Route: <sip:217.73.174.13:5060;lr
..From: sip:1001@217.73.174.13;tag=1065314925..To: sip:1001@217.73.174.13..Call-ID: 807187534@82.79.243.82..CSeq: 1 REGISTER..Conta
ct: sip:1001@82.79.243.82:5060..Max-Forwards: 70..User-Agent: wengo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 2940..Content-Length: 0.... # U 217.73.174.13:5060 -> 82.79.243.82:5060 SIP/2.0 401 Unauthorized..Via: SIP/2.0/UDP 82.79.243.82:5060;rport=5060;branch=z9hG4bK1094221745..From: sip:1001@217.73.174.13;tag=106 5314925..To: sip:1001@217.73.174.13;tag=5e02e7658def22f683939a852e493344.4bcc..Call-ID: 807187534@82.79.243.82..CSeq: 1 REGISTER..WWW- Authenticate: Digest realm="217.73.174.13", nonce="46823bd9c467d1377ec65d343c7dfc7bd40513c3"..Server: OpenSER (1.2.1-notls (x86_64/linux ))..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 REGISTER sip:217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K2031845783;xxx-nat-type=sym..Route: <sip:217. 73.174.13:5060;lr>..From: sip:1001@217.73.174.13;tag=1065314925..To: sip:1001@217.73.174.13..Call-ID: 807187534@82.79.243.82..CSeq: 2 REGISTER..Contact: sip:1001@82.79.243.82:5060..Authorization: Digest username="1001", realm="217.73.174.13", nonce="46823bd9c467d137 7ec65d343c7dfc7bd40513c3", uri="sip:217.73.174.13", response="2e3d2c8bb188495863d4306f5cd5ba5c", algorithm=MD5..Max-Forwards: 70..User-A gent: wengo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 2940..Content-Length: 0.... # U 217.73.174.13:5060 -> 82.79.243.82:5060 SIP/2.0 200 OK..Via: SIP/2.0/UDP 82.79.243.82:5060;rport=5060;branch=z9hG4bK2031845783;xxx-nat-type=sym..From: sip:1001@217.73.174.13; tag=1065314925..To: sip:1001@217.73.174.13;tag=5e02e7658def22f683939a852e493344.142c..Call-ID: 807187534@82.79.243.82..CSeq: 2 REGISTE R..Contact: sip:1001@82.79.243.82:5060;expires=2940..Server: OpenSER (1.2.1-notls (x86_64/linux))..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... # U 82.79.243.82:5060 -> 217.73.174.13:5060 OPTIONS sip:ping@217.73.174.13 SIP/2.0..Via: SIP/2.0/UDP 82.79.243.82:5060;rport;branch=z9hG4bK1028071012..From: Radu <sip:1001@217.73.1 74.13>;tag=675779892..To: sip:ping@217.73.174.13..Call-ID: 1333741103@82.79.243.82..CSeq: 20 OPTIONS..Max-Forwards: 70..User-Agent: we ngo/v1/wengophoneng/wengo/rev0/trunk/..Expires: 120..Accept: application/sdp..Content-Length: 0.... exit 14 received, 0 dropped
Hi!
1. please use "ngrep -W byline ......" 2. wengophone registers successfully to openser 3. it sends OPTIONS sip:ping@......
Although the user "ping" is unknown to openser it should at least reply with some error message - e.g. 404. Thus I guess you have a bug in your config.
regards klaus
Radu Spineanu wrote:
Hi,
I have a working basic openser + asterisk setup. Twinkle works OK and wengophone doesn't. It tries to connect and then after a while times out.
While debugging I noticed a lot of OPTIONS ping requests are going unanswered by openser because it contains an user in the uri. Registration seems to be working OK.
I've attached the ngrep output that shows this.
Has anyone got wengophone to work with openser?
-- Radu Spineanu
Users mailing list Users@openser.org http://openser.org/cgi-bin/mailman/listinfo/users
We have a few users using Wengophone on our OpenSER 1.2.1 server. Works just fine - or as expected I believe. However those pings are annoying... It keeps sending OPTIONS to sip:ping@ourdomain.tld every 20 seconds or so...
// sip:gojensen@uninett.no | h323: 004710012 pstn: +47 73 55 79 23 | fax: +47 73 55 79 01
-----Original Message----- From: users-bounces@openser.org [mailto:users-bounces@openser.org] On Behalf Of Klaus Darilion Sent: Thursday, June 28, 2007 10:00 AM To: Radu Spineanu Cc: users@openser.org Subject: Re: [OpenSER-Users] wengophone and openser
Hi!
- please use "ngrep -W byline ......"
- wengophone registers successfully to openser 3. it sends
OPTIONS sip:ping@......
Although the user "ping" is unknown to openser it should at least reply with some error message - e.g. 404. Thus I guess you have a bug in your config.
regards klaus
Radu Spineanu wrote:
Hi,
I have a working basic openser + asterisk setup. Twinkle
works OK and
wengophone doesn't. It tries to connect and then after a
while times out.
While debugging I noticed a lot of OPTIONS ping requests are going unanswered by openser because it contains an user in the uri. Registration seems to be working OK.
I've attached the ngrep output that shows this.
Has anyone got wengophone to work with openser?
-- Radu Spineanu
--
Users mailing list Users@openser.org http://openser.org/cgi-bin/mailman/listinfo/users
Users mailing list Users@openser.org http://openser.org/cgi-bin/mailman/listinfo/users